Scientists monitor emerging strain for potential immune escape as surveillance efforts intensify
A newly identified
COVID-19 variant in the United Kingdom has prompted close monitoring by health authorities amid concerns that it may partially evade protection provided by existing
vaccines.
Researchers have detected the strain through ongoing genomic surveillance, which continues to play a central role in tracking the evolution of the virus.
Early findings suggest that the variant carries mutations that could affect how the immune system recognises it, raising questions about the level of protection offered by prior vaccination or infection.
Health officials have emphasised that investigations are still at an early stage, and there is currently no evidence to indicate a significant increase in severe illness or hospitalisation linked to the new strain.
However, the possibility of reduced
vaccine effectiveness has led to heightened attention and further study.
Authorities are continuing to assess the variant’s transmissibility and clinical impact, while reinforcing the importance of existing public health measures and vaccination programmes.
Experts note that
vaccines remain a critical tool in reducing severe outcomes, even as the virus evolves.
The emergence of the strain highlights the ongoing challenge of managing
COVID-19 as it continues to adapt.
Surveillance systems in the UK and internationally are being used to detect and respond to such developments promptly, ensuring that policymakers and healthcare systems remain prepared.
Scientists have indicated that updates to
vaccines or booster strategies could be considered if evidence shows a meaningful change in protection levels.
For now, the focus remains on gathering data and understanding the characteristics of the new variant as part of a broader effort to maintain public health resilience.
